Michael Madsen stars in director Tom Holland’s Rock, Paper, Scissors

May 17, 2019 by Amie Cranswick

Lionsgate has announced the home entertainment release of the upcoming thriller Rock, Paper, Scissors. Directed by Tom Holland (Child’s Play), the film stars Luke Macfarlane as a rehabilitated serial killer who was recently released from a psychiatric care who finds himself menaced by the officer (Michael Madsen) who put him away; watch the trailer here…

From the writer of Friday the 13th and the director of Child’s Play comes this tale of a serial killer that’s been cured… or has he? Released from a mental hospital, Peter (Luke Macfarlane, “Brothers & Sisters”) is haunted by memories of childhood abuse and murder victims while being menaced by the cop who put him away (Michael Madsen, The Hateful Eight). His only friend is pretty neighbor Monica, who says she wants to interview him for a book… but does she have a more sinister scheme in mind?

Rock, Paper, Scissors is set for a Blu-ray, DVD and digital release on July 23rd.
